    Both are herding dogs and require alot of activity to keep healthy. Border Collies originated in the border region between Scotland and Wales, while the Australian Shepard originated in the U.S. The aussies come in many different colors, like the BC, such as black, white, red, merled and combinations. Aussies generally have their tailed "cropped." The breed standard for both, as defined by the AKC, has resulted in very pretty and stupid dogs. Also considerable genetic defects such as blindness and deafness.

    Good breeders, who breed for performance and intelligence, rather than the AKC standard, produce ultimate puppies.
